More for ebay.com than ebay.co.uk2
Don't get me wrong this book has some good tips for people who want to become a powerseller but about 30-50% of the book is aimed at ebay.com which means that you can't use that information. It refers to a lot of american sites for reference. That's the only disappointing bit, when you get to a bit that you can do it is very helpful!

Best Book For eBay Selling5
I agree with the previous reviewer that there are a few links here more appropriate for U.S. sellers, but the great majority of the information applies to all sellers. The authors cover everything from sourcing product to shipping and customer service. They gathered the best tips from a lot of PowerSellers so what's here isn't just their own opinion. There are also profiles of PowerSellers which can be inspiring.

Recommended Book5
This book is a must for all those who aspire to power seller status on ebay. So many books provide a boring account of the help pages anyone can easily access on ebay itself whereas this book bypasses all of that assuming you already know the basic stuff. It offers invaluable tips throughout and after each chapter a very useful checklist of what you should now know and already be putting into practice. All of the information provided is offered from years of experience by two seasoned ebay sellers together with case studies of real life power sellers which are truly inspiring. Although the book is American the information provided is invaluable and can still be applied for those who wish to become a Power Seller in the UK.
